COLDWATER, MI (WTVB) – The Coldwater Cardinals used a pair of first half touchdowns from freshman Cameron Torres to defeat the Harper Creek Beavers 14-7 on Friday night in the Cardinals Purple Game to fight cancer at Cardinal Field. Torres scored from three and 12 yards out. Harper Creek scored midway through the third quarter to cut the lead to seven but they could get no closer. Coldwater had a 292-180 edge in total yards and had possession of the ball for 28 minutes. Matt Gipple carried the ball 14 times for 85 yards. He also had four tackles on defense.
Our McDonald’s Players of the Game were Coldwater offensive lineman Kenny Cramer and running back Cole Barker.
The Cardinals are now 7-1 overall and they claim second place in the Interstate 8 at 6-1.
